[Asia Economy Reporter Joselgina] SK Telecom announced on the 1st that it will release the Canada edition of the untact travel event 'TravelON Mood,' which allows vivid experiences of overseas destinations through videos.


'TravelON Mood' is a self-planned event by SK Telecom that introduces every corner of famous local tourist attractions online. Starting with the Paris edition in July, it has delivered popular tourist destinations such as Hawaii vividly to domestic viewers, receiving great responses.


This Canada edition was produced in cooperation with the Canada Tourism Commission. Featuring local professional guides and staff from the local tourism office, it provides abundant information about Canadian tourist spots popular among Korean tourists. It delivers various experiences such as the stunning scenery of the world-famous maple leaf spot Maple Road, cruises at Niagara Falls, and winery tours.


The ‘TravelON Mood’ Canada edition can be viewed on SK Telecom’s official YouTube channel (https://youtu.be/GvsXbfSb_2U).


A representative from the Canada Tourism Commission said, "This collaboration was proposed with the hope that everyone going through difficult times can find comfort by appreciating Canada’s great nature," adding, "We hope that through the mysterious great nature such as Niagara Falls, people can momentarily put down their worries and concerns."



Song Gwanghyun, head of SK Telecom’s PR2 Office, said, "This content was planned to provide enjoyable and unique experiences to customers who find it difficult to travel due to the COVID-19 pandemic," and added, "SK Telecom will continue to strive to bring joy to customers by utilizing New ICT technologies such as 5G and AI."
